To install SSL into the QNAP NAS ,you can use the OpenSSL tool to create the CSR and Private key. To generate a pair of private key and public Certificate Signing Request (CSR) for a webserver, "server", use the following command : openssl req -nodes -newkey rsa:2048 -keyout myserver.key -out server.csr. If you replace your myQNAPcloud certificate or reset it to default, the certificate you installed using the myQNAPcloud SSL Certificate Wizard will be considered invalid. You will have to click "Release" on the SSL Certificate page in myQNAPcloud and then re-apply the certificate to your device. Unable to add to cart.
